medicaL marveL Nesochi Okeke-Igbokwe ’99, M.D., M.S. Nesochi Okeke-igbokwe is currently a clinical instructor of medicine at Nyu School of medicine and a hospitalist attending physician at Nyu’s Langone medical center. She received a medical degree from Georgetown university School of medicine and completed her residency training in internal medicine at New york Presbyterian/Queens. Nesochi holds a master’s degree in clinical evaluative sciences with a concentration in epidemiology/biostatistics from Dartmouth College, where she received training in health services research and also conducted analyses of the quality of data in contemporary medical literature. She completed her undergraduate degree in biology with honors at Boston University. She is also a member of the inaugural class of Bill and Melinda Gates Scholars. She has been featured and quoted in numerous media outlets including Forbes, Vogue, Better Homes & Gardens, CBS News, Glamour, Teen Vogue, InStyle, Self and Today. Nesochi says, “While I was at Newark Academy, it was truly a blessing to be taught by phenomenal teachers like Mr. Joseph Ball and Mlle. Kareen Obydol. Both teachers were incredibly inspiring and continuously encouraged me to pursue my dreams. I am forever grateful for their mentorship, guidance and support.”
